stc pay Bahrain, the kingdom's innovative and accessible mobile wallet for digital financial transactions, has announced a strategic partnership with Global Payment Services (GPS), a Bahrain-based payment infrastructure provider and leading enabler of secure and innovative digital payment solutions.
This collaboration is part of stc pay’s ongoing investment in building a secure, scalable, and world-class digital payment infrastructure for Bahrain, it said.
The partnership enables stc pay to enhance its card and digital payment services by leveraging GPS’s 20+ years of payment processing expertise. It will strengthen the reliability, scalability, and security of stc pay’s ecosystem, specifically supporting cards and the digital payment transactions. This initiative expands stc pay’s interoperability with global payment networks and reinforces its commitment to supporting the growth and innovation of Bahrain's digital economy, stc pay said.
